Hall of Fame baseball player and announcer George Kell passed away

Andrew Norton

Ex-Tigers Hall of Famer, George Kell, passed away today at 86. He had a .306 average for his 15 year career that saw him play for Philadelphia (1943-1946), Detroit (1946-1952), Boston (1952-1954), Chicago White Sox (1954-1956), and Baltimore (1956-1957). He was a broadcaster for the Tigers television broadcasts from 1959 to 1996. Kell and Al Kaline shared the broadcast booth from 1975 until he retired in 1996.

Surfing the Great Lakes

Andrew Norton

You can't surf the Great Lakes. At least that is what the "experts" say. This video proves otherwise. This documentary is called, "Unsalted: A Great Lakes Experience." When they show guys surfing Lake Superior wearing extra thick wetsuits and talking about the water being 33 degrees - it made me shiver. It's an incredible sight to see guys surfing with ice chunks floating amongst the waves. That's dedication to a sport or just plain crazy.
